
A new downtown restaurant The 8 opened in late July right across from the Dayton Dragons’ Day Air Ballpark. The restaurant is a second venture for Jay and Deepika Singh, the owners of Gulzar’s Indian Cuisine located right next door.
The 8 offers tacos, burgers, chicken wings and other casual fare.
It’s also notable because the concept is to be a sports bar, which many have said is still needed in Downtown Dayton. Some bars have picked up a reputation as sports destinations, ranging from Troll Pub and Oregon Express to Dayton Beer Company and Pins Mechanical, but establishments truly prioritizing sports are still few and far between.
The 8 is located at 217 Patterson Boulevard, the same space that Gulzar’s initially occupied when it opened in May 2022.
But after Flyboy’s Deli closed its location next door at 219 Patterson the following year, Gulzar’s eventually moved into its larger space. Now its owners are operating two restaurants right next door to each other, and although the concepts are quite different, both are enjoying success.
And overall this block of Patterson Boulevard is quite active with those two restaurants as well as Winans on the other side of Gulzar’s, offering more destinations for visitors to Dragons games, RiverScape MetroPark, as well as residents of the Delco and Water Street apartments,
